Skip to content

Releases: UnLovedCookie/Network

Network Optimization Batch Release 2.0

31 Oct 08:50
58e3fbe
Compare
Choose a tag to compare

Batch Updates

  • Use the powershell execution policy bypass
  • Include full names of acronyms
  • Change all values associated with optimizations
  • Update MinSudo to preview 3

Power Management

  • Disable More Network Adapter Power Saving

Congestion Control and Detection

  • Enable Explicit Congestion Notification (ECN)
  • Enable Path Maximum Transfer Unit (PMTU) Black Hole Detection

Quality of Service (QoS)

  • Enable QoS Packet Scheduler (Psched)
  • Optimize DSCP For Certain Applications
  • Lower QoS Timer Resolution

Data Transfer Optimization

  • Enable Transfers Larger Than 64KB
  • Set Max Receive Buffers
  • Set Max Transmit Buffers
  • Set Optimal MTU

Connection Management

  • Increase ARP Cache Size to 4096
  • Increase Concurrent Connections on Explorer
  • Increase Maximum Outstanding Network Requests

TCP Settings

  • Fixed Disable Flow Control
  • Fixed Disable TCP 1323 Timestamps

Network Flushing

  • Delete Address Resolution Protocol (ARP) Cache
  • Wipe The Windows CryptNet SSL Certificate Cache
  • Reset Additional TCP/IP Stack Segments

Network Optimization Batch Release 1.1

25 Jul 06:16
58e3fbe
Compare
Choose a tag to compare

Batch Updates

  • Download MinSudo From The Official Github Repo
  • Prompt before restarting the network adapter

TCP/IP Features

  • Disable Memory Pressure Protection (MPP)

More info on the doc.

Network Optimization Batch Release 1.0

16 Jul 09:27
8414f75
Compare
Choose a tag to compare

Network Stack Configuration

  • Reset TCP/IP Stack
  • Renew IP Address
  • Flush DNS Cache
  • Restart Network Adapter

Offloading and Optimization

  • Disable IPsec Task Offload and TCP Chimney Offload
  • Enable Large Send Offload (LSO)
  • Enable Network Task Offloading
  • Enable Direct Cache Access (DCA)
  • Enable RSS (Receive Side Scaling)
  • Enable Fast Send Datagram

Performance Improvements

  • Enable Auto-Tuning
  • Increase IRPStackSize
  • Improve Live Migration
  • Enable Weak Host Model
  • Set Congestion Provider to BBR2/NewReno
  • Increase TCP Initial Congestion Window
  • Lower Initial RTO
  • Increase Concurrent Connections Limit

TCP/IP Features

  • Enable UDP and TCP Checksums
  • Enable TCP Selective Acks
  • Enable Path MTU
  • Disable Window Scaling Heuristics
  • Disable TCP 1323 Timestamps
  • Disable Nagle's Algorithm

Network Behavior Modifications

  • Disable Flow Control
  • Disable Interrupt Moderation
  • Disable Receive Segment Coalescing State (RSC)
  • Disable DMA Coalescing
  • Disable Packet Coalescing
  • Disable Network Power Savings
  • Disable Delivery Optimization
  • Disable Network Throttling
  • Disable Connected Standby

Connection Management

  • Lower Max SYN Retransmissions
  • Decrease length of TIME_WAIT state
  • Remove TCP Connection Limit
  • Set Dynamic Port Range to Maximum
  • Quality of Service and Configuration
  • Lower Time To Live
  • Increase Network Priority
  • Set Network Adapter Interrupt Priority to Undefined
  • Set Network Adapter Policy to IrqPolicySpreadMessagesAcrossAllProcessors
  • Enable Network Adapter MSI Mode

DNS and Name Resolution

  • Disable NetBIOS
  • Disable LLMNR
  • Enable DNS over HTTPS

Miscellaneous

  • Disable RTT resiliency for non-SACK clients
  • Disable Buffer List Tracking